The Venue and Atmosphere

Located in the “most castiza” area of Madrid—El Madrid de los Austrias—Las Carboneras is described as an “avant-garde” tablao that burst onto the scene at the dawn of the 21st century. The space itself seems to be a cozy, intimate setting that fosters close-up views of the artists. Several reviews highlight enjoying the venue itself, with one reviewer noting that they “enjoyed the show and the venue,” suggesting the atmosphere is welcoming and well-suited for a cultural night out.

The venue is also decorated with exhibitions of plastic and photographic art, occasionally featuring flamenco-themed displays, adding to the overall cultural experience. This creates a layered environment where visual arts and live performance come together, enriching the evening.

The Drinks and Food

Included is a drink, such as a soft drink, water, wine, sangria, beer, or juice. Guests seem to appreciate this added touch, allowing them to relax and enjoy the show without extra costs. Some reviews praise the quality of the drinks, especially the wine and sangria, which contribute to the festive atmosphere.

While food is available—described as a traditional Spanish cuisine—it’s not the main focus. One reviewer mentioned the food looked delicious but didn’t comment on it directly, and most seem to agree that the performance is the highlight.

Ticketing and Price

At around $53.41 per person, the price is quite reasonable, especially given the high praise for the quality of the acts. The inclusion of a drink adds to the perceived value, making it a good deal for a cultural night out.

The tickets are mobile, making booking straightforward, and the cancelation policy is flexible—free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ance offers peace of mind if your plans change.

Drawbacks and Things to Keep in Mind

While most reviews are glowing, some mention small downsides. For example, the food options—though seemingly tasty—are not the main attraction and might not satisfy those expecting a full dinner experience. One review pointed out that the sangria served was more like fruit juice, which could be disappointing if you’re expecting a more traditional, robust drink.

Plus, some guests might find the one-hour duration too brief if they love flamenco and want a longer show. However, this short duration is also a plus for fitting into a busy evening schedule.
